One of the finest theatres in the Theatreland in the West End was opened in 1905. It carried several different names in the past and in 2005 it finally got its current name. The theatre now takes its name after Ivor Novello, a Welsh composer and actor, who lived in a flat above the theatre from 1913 to 1951.
